Is your aircon in Singapore not cooling well? One common reason is low refrigerant gas. Your aircon needs the right gas level to keep rooms cool. Without it, the system struggles and costs more to run. So, let’s look at five clear signs that your aircon gas may be running low.

https://www.istockphoto.com/photo/stressed-woman-has-problem-with-the-air-conditioner-at-home-gm1346484720-424240000?utm_source=pexels&utm_medium=affiliate&utm_campaign=sponsored_photo&utm_content=srp_inline_media&utm_term=AIRCON%20PROBLEM

1. Weak Cooling

First, if your aircon takes too long to cool the room or never feels cold enough, gas levels may be low. Without enough refrigerant, the system cannot release heat properly. As a result, cooling slows down. Many homeowners solve this with an aircon gas top-up in Singapore.

2. Blowing Warm Air

Next, does your unit blow warm or room-temperature air even after hours? This often means low aircon gas. In other words, without enough refrigerant, cooling simply won’t happen.

3. Ice on the Coils

In addition, look at your indoor unit. If you see ice on the coils or pipes, gas levels may be too low. Ice forms when the coils get too cold and freeze moisture in the air. Furthermore, dirt buildup can make this worse. Sometimes, an aircon chemical wash in Singapore is also needed to restore performance.

4. Strange Noises

Moreover, hissing or bubbling sounds often point to a gas leak. Since refrigerant should stay sealed, these noises mean something is wrong. Therefore, it’s best to call an aircon repair service in Singapore right away.

5. High Electricity Bills

Finally, a sudden rise in your electricity bill can be a clue. When gas is low, your unit works harder to cool. Consequently, this uses more power and drives up costs. Regular aircon servicing in Singapore helps prevent this.
